

It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Fred Tokaryk, age 74, of Peterborough, Ontario on December 30, 2023, surrounded by loved ones at Peterborough Regional Health Centre after a short illness.
Fred was born to Nicholas and Mary (Kendra) Tokaryk in Ottawa, where he spent his childhood. He moved to Halifax for his physical education degree at Dalhousie University where he also met his best friend and wife, Nancy (Dunbrack). Active in varsity sport, Fred was selected to play defensive tackle for the Ottawa Rough Riders but returned to Halifax to be with Nancy. After university Fred taught at various schools within the Halifax Regional Schoolboard, including St. Joseph’s A. McKay, Central Spryfield and St. Catherine’s Elementary School. He owned and managed Nautilus Fitness Center on Harvard Street in Halifax, before moving the business to Dalplex.
In his free-time he was very active in the local sports, whether it was coaching minor league hockey, high school football (Halifax West, 1988) or the West End Steelers Girls Basketball team which he co-coached with Nancy for many years.
After his retirement, Fred was hardly seen without his beloved Beagle, Bagel. He traveled frequently, visiting his son, Scott, and his family in Germany. From there he experienced France, Italy (where he acquired a fondness for gnocchi), Austria, Denmark, Poland and Ukraine. Fred spent his final years in Peterborough to be close to his daughter, Sarah, and her family.
Fred was always the life of the party and loved to laugh. His granddaughters (Samantha, Nathalie, Madison and Leah) will particularly miss their Gido for his one of a kind humour which brought a smile to everyone he knew.
He was predeceased by Nancy, his parents and brother (Ted). He is survived by son Scott (Jana), daughter Sarah, sister Sue of Westport, Ontario as well as his granddaughters as well as his nieces and nephews.
